Long gone are those days with these new solid state finals. I use my amp on all the bands it’s designed for and get 1000 watts out no problems. Rock solid amp. I wonder how many hours/years it will do me good for. I think it will be comparable to buying a modern radio. Who knows. But one thing I can say is, I use my amp a lot. I now have over 100k contacts (estimate easily over 20k with the LA1K). I been contesting with this amp and many hours rock solid performer. I push this amp to 900-1000w With 40w drive. On 15m and 17m for some reason I have to back down the drive to around 25w to get 1000w out. I guess that’s where it’s most efficient.? I don’t wanna get into semantics here but I only use my trusty heath kit sm-2140 which I have checked with a bird and it’s close enough for me, the govt and most others. I use the 50w power out restriction in the ftdx5000 so I never overdrive the LA1K. I have at times, due to ice on some of my warm dipoles swr as high as 2.2 and the amp still works fine. Quite amazing. Most of the time swr is down around 1.1 - 1.5.? I don’t worry about using full 1000w out. It’s made to handle it.? 4 years of hard contesting full out. No problem. The hottest it’s gotten is 67C. I back off for a few minutes it goes back to 45C. Nice.? Using 240v here. There are some around here that think other amps are better. Maybe they are.
